**Understanding Intelligent Ink**
Intelligent ink refers to a category of inks that possess enhanced functionalities beyond traditional printing. These inks can change color, react to environmental stimuli, or even display digital information. The primary aim of intelligent inks is to create dynamic materials that can provide additional information or interactivity to the user. For instance, thermochromic inks change color in response to temperature variations, while photochromic inks react to light exposure.
The development of intelligent inks has been significantly accelerated by advances in nanotechnology. By manipulating materials at the molecular or atomic level, researchers can create inks that are not only more versatile but also more efficient. The incorporation of nanoparticles into ink formulations allows for the creation of inks that can perform specific functions, such as conductivity, sensing, or even self-healing properties.
**Nanotechnology: The Game Changer**
Nanotechnology plays a crucial role in the development of intelligent inks. By utilizing nanoparticles—tiny particles that are 1 to 100 nanometers in size—scientists can enhance the properties of traditional inks. For example, the addition of silver nanoparticles can impart antimicrobial properties, making inks suitable for medical applications. Additionally, carbon nanotubes can be incorporated to create conductive inks that can be used in printed electronics.
The ability to engineer materials at the nanoscale allows for greater control over the physical and chemical properties of inks. This control enables the creation of inks that can respond to external stimuli, such as temperature, humidity, or even pH levels. As a result, the applications of intelligent inks become virtually limitless, ranging from packaging and labeling to advanced electronic devices.

**Advancements in Printed Electronics**
The field of printed electronics is another area where intelligent inks and nanotechnology are making a significant impact. Conductive inks, which are made using nanoparticles like silver or carbon nanotubes, can be printed onto various substrates to create flexible and lightweight electronic devices. This technology has the potential to revolutionize the production of sensors, displays, and even wearable technology.
For instance, smart textiles that can monitor vital signs or environmental conditions can be produced using conductive inks. These textiles could find applications in healthcare, sports, and military settings, where real-time data collection is crucial. Additionally, printed sensors can be integrated into everyday objects, enabling the development of the Internet of Things (IoT) and smart home technologies.
